Overclockers dream: E3900
Intel is planning to release a new Celeron chip - good to know they are'nt making LGA775 obsolete yet!
The new chip is to be released in 2010. Named the E3900, it will probably be the last model in the E3xxx series. Its based on the wolfdale, has 1MB of L3 Cache and runs at a blistering 3.4GHZ But the best thing is, it is only 800Mhz QDR FSB. Supports x64, but no intel VT or any trusted execution features. This is pretty much a basic workhorse chip. I can imagine some great OC results from this. The low FSB/low cache combo always makes for a good OC. Not sure what the volts are, hopefully low with some nice headroom. Re: Overclockers dream: E3900
Damn.
http://www.techpowerup.com/102396/In..._for_2010.html That's like an overclocker's wet dream. And I thought having an x11 multi made me hot ****. Only thing is, with a multi that high it may be reaching the point where you derive no benefit from the extra clocks. You see, the multiplier is a ratio, of how many CPU cycles occur per bus cycle. In this case, that means that the CPU receives data from the bus--and then goes seventeen cycles without receiving more data! Commands that will take a full 17 clock cycles to execute are fairly rare--most are under 10 from what I understand. Thus you receive a set of commands to execute them, you finish them in say twelve clock cycles--then you're sitting around for another five waiting to send the answer back to the RAM and receive a new command. Thus 5/17 of your ultra-high clock speed is wasted in that instance. So in this case, although having a low FSB with an extremely high multi means that you can overclock to ridiculous numbers (you can break the 4.0GHz barrier with just a 40MHz increase!), it may actually give less real world performance-per-clock-cycle than a CPU with a high FSB and low multi, like the E8x00 series. EDIT: The voltage maximum for these 45nm chips is usually around 1.3625V. One thing I like about the E2xxx and E4xxx series, the 65nm architecture means you can take it as high as 1.5V before exceeding the rated maximum, and I've had this E2200 up to 1.56V without it frying.

Re: Overclockers dream: E3900
You know, I wonder how this thing would perform if you dropped the multi to x12 and increased the FSB? Normally I don't like that form of overclocking because it puts more strain on the motherboard and increases instability. However, if this CPU is capable of such high clock speeds then there's no sense wasting them twiddling its thumbs waiting for instructions. A multi of x12 and FSB of 375 (1500... high, but manageable on high end boards) would give you a clock speed of 4500MHz. I expect that would be the most performance you could get out of this chip, and it's a lot of performance! Again, though, there's the issue of instability, and the bus wall. I don't know. Maybe a compromise? Multi = x14, FSB= 300MHz?
But though this is obviously appealing to overclockers who care more about clock speed than real performance, I think the real reason Intel has gone with this combination of low FSB and high multi is because it gives them the ability to put a processor with a very, very high clock speed onto very low-end motherboards that don't support the higher bus speed needed for CPUs like the E7x00 and E8x00 processors. Thus I expect to see a lot of these in 2010/11's OEM machines.

Re: Overclockers dream: E3900
Yeah, you can drop the multi to x6 on any Core 2 chip. The thing I'm worried about is if it will be stable at higher bus speeds. Even with my E2200's multi set at x8 (it gets a little unstable below that) I can't get the FSB over 360MHz. At the stock x11 I can get to 290 and still be stable, it will boot at 300MHz but runs very hot and crashes if you try to run a strenuous program like a game. I've found the best compromise between heat, stability, and performance is 270x11 @ 1.46V = 2970MHz.
What I would like to be able to reach with an E3900 would be 350x12 @ 1.35V = 4200MHz. I figure that would be the most you could get with good air cooling, assuming the chip runs really cool for its clock. With water cooling you could probably reach 375x12 @ 1.36V = 4500MHz which should be enough for anyone.
